At a time when money is tight and food prices seem to be rocketing it’s important for us to get the best value for our money when it comes to our supermarket shopping. Best value doesn’t necessarily mean buying the cheapest – often the cheapest prices mean lesser quality and more waste.

A smaller portion of quality food provides better nutritional value than a larger portion of cheap but just-about-edible offerings. If you really need to cut your food bills down then investigate thoroughly what you are really spending your money on. But one get one free may seem a good deal but only if you will really use the food as part of a meal and not as an ‘extra’.

Remember it is always more cost effective to prepare fresh food than it is to buy ‘convenience’ foods and almost always nutritionally better.

If shortness of time is your main consideration then consider doing a ‘cookery freezer’ day when you have enough time to prepare as many dishes as you can and freeze for a later date.

There are also many recipe books on the market for short-of-time cooks. If you internet shop, spend a little time checking out the offers or cheaper alternatives to see if they are cost effective – Tesco website has many useful hints, tips and recipes all with saving money in mind, they also have a meals for under a fiver booklet which is really useful for providing for a family.



                  
 

Tomato, Olive and Onion Salad

(Serves 8 People)
Ingredients

8 large tomatoes, sliced
1 large onion, thinly sliced
50g pot of olives
3 tbsps Virgin Olive Oil
1 tbsp white wine vinegar
4 radishes, thinly sliced
1 tspn mustard


Instructions

• Layer the tomatoes into a flat shallow dish

• Layer the onion over the tomatoes then layer the radish on top

• Scatter the olives onto the layers

• Whisk together the oil, white wine vinegar and mustard, season with pepper and drizzle over salad

• Serve immediately with French bread to mop up juices.


    
 

                  

Quick Dish

Asparagus is a lovely dish at any time of year but for a light spring lunch it couldn’t be better or easier. After trimming the asparagus ends boil or steam until just tender.

Whilst still hot wrap two slices of wafer thin ham around three spears per person. Lie on a plate and sprinkle generously with a grated cheese or your choice. Serve with crusty bread or rolls for a light yet tasty lunch.

                  
Quick Dish

For a truly tasty snack, break some mushrooms into a small pan with a lump of butter and heat until light brown.

Put onto a baking tray and squirt a little garlic paste onto each piece and grill until paste has melted. Serve on a slice of chunky toast and sprinkle the whole thing with Red Leicester cheese, grated.
